International Review For Spatial Planning And Sustainable Development(中文译名:《空间规划与可持续发展的国际评论》),ISSN:2187-3666,是Spatial Planning and Sustainable Development出版的国际性学术期刊,以4 issues/year形式稳定发行,2026年总发文量约60篇。该刊采用非OA开放访问,学科归属为GREEN & SUSTAINABLE SCIENCE & TECHNOLOGY。该刊是管理学、绿色可持续发展技术领域的国际权威刊物,已被SCIE(科学引文索引扩展版)、EI(工程索引)等国际主流学术数据库收录。2026年期刊影响因子达1.7,2025年期刊CiteScore为3.4,2025年期刊自引率约41.2%,在中科院期刊分区体系中位列管理学大类3区,在所属学科领域具备高学术影响力与国际认可度。International Review For Spatial Planning And Sustainable Development长期聚焦管理学、绿色可持续发展技术及相关产业的技术应用前沿,在稿件录用评判中,该刊将创新性与前沿性作为核心遴选标准,重点收录能够对管理学、绿色可持续发展技术领域的落地与发展产生实质性推动价值的研究成果。

从全球发文格局来看,CHINA MAINLANDJapan、Indonesia、South Korea、UNITED ARAB EMIRATES、Taiwan、Algeria等为核心发文国家与地区;SEOUL NATIONAL UNIVERSITY (SNU)ABU DHABI UNIVERSITY、MERDEKA MALANG UNIVERSITY、KANAZAWA UNIVERSITY、TSINGHUA UNIVERSITY、UNIVERSITAS TADULAKO、TONGJI UNIVERSITY等高校与科研机构是期刊的主要发文单位。

名词解释:

影响因子(Impact Factor, IF):指该期刊前两年发表的文章,在第三年的平均被引用次数。它反映了期刊的近期平均影响力和热度。

中科院分区:中科院分区表是国内主流的学术期刊分级评价工具,核心意义是建立跨学科可比的统一评价标尺,为职称评审、学位授予、科研立项等科研管理工作提供标准化量化依据,同时帮助科研人员筛选优质期刊、规避学术风险,适配国内本土化的科研评价需求。
